Automobile beam steel with tensile strength of 610MPa and preparation method for automobile beam steel

2015 
The invention provides automobile beam steel with tensile strength of 610MPa and a preparation method for the automobile beam steel. The automobile beam steel comprises the following chemical components in percentage by mass: 0.04-0.12% of C, 0.05-0.35% of Si, 0.8-1.4% of Mn, less than and equal to 0.015% of S, less than and equal to 0.02% of P, 0.02-0.05% of Als, 0.04-0.08% of Ti, and the balance of Fe and inevitable impurities. The tissue of the automobile beam steel is quasi-polygonal ferrite and bainite, wherein the volume fraction of the quasi-polygonal ferrite is 85-95%, the volume fraction of the bainite is 5-15%, and the mean grain size is 3-6 microns. The invention further provides a preparation method for the automobile beam steel. A steel billet adopting the chemical component proportion is subjected to a reasonable process design, cheap micro alloy titanium is used to replace precious micro alloy niobium and vanadium, the production cost is reduced while load of a rolling mill and a reeling machine is reduced, the production efficiency is improved, and the automobile beam steel with tensile strength of 630 MPa to 690 MPa is obtained.
